What YOU will bring as Psychologist/Psychological Associate:
- MA / PhD / PsyD in a Social, Clinical, Counseling, etc. program
- Registration with the CPO
- Minimum 3 years of experience in assessment, treatment planning, and provision of psychotherapy services for adolescents and/or adults
- Training in evidencebased interventions and a strong interest in psychotherapy integration
- Excellent case conceptualization skills
- Family and Couple therapy experience would be an asset
- Fluency in a second language such as Hindi, Urdu, Punjabi, Farsi, Bengali,
- BIPOC folx and those who identify with a marginalized group are particularly encouraged to apply
